Stress was literally killing Ari Meisel. Working 18-hour days on construction projects while battling "incurable" Crohn's disease, he faced an impossible choice: keep working and die, or stop working and watch his business collapse. Instead of accepting either fate, he did something radical-he questioned the entire premise. What if the problem wasn't too much work but too much inefficiency? What if doing less could actually accomplish more? This counterintuitive insight became the foundation of a system that not only helped him overcome his supposedly incurable disease but also complete an Ironman triathlon while working a fraction of his previous hours. The secret wasn't superhuman willpower or endless hustle-it was systematically identifying what truly mattered and ruthlessly eliminating everything else.
